
Dragons Add Infielder Prior To Monday's Home Opener
Published on April 7, 2008 under Midwest League (MWL1)
Dayton Dragons News Release
Dayton, OH - The Dayton Dragons announced today that catcher Tony Esquer has been promoted to the Sarasota Reds of the Florida State League. Esquer has been replaced on the Dragons roster by infielder Jake Kahaulelio. Kahaulelio had been in extended spring training in Sarasota.
Kahaulelio was selected in the 20th round in 2007 by the Reds out of Oral Roberts University. He did not play professionally last summer after being drafted.
Esquer had appeared in one game with the Dragons, going 0 for 3. He spent most of the 2007 season with Dayton, batting .217 in 52 games.
